In the May '99 issue
of Scientific American (pg. 22, "Supply and Demand"), which reported
on a paper in the Feb 7, '99 issue of Proceedings of the Royal Society: Biological
Sciences, the editors examine the market value of mate choice - a favorite of
evolutionary biologists. The article sampled personal ads to determine what
men and women want from each other. They found that men want fecundity (youth),
beauty and social skills, in that order. Women who possess those attributes
demand young, rich, good looking men. Men's "market value" depends
mostly upon income and future pair bond termination (age).
